Worth a separate page. It's clear that KiwiRail is not part of ONTRACK, rather that they are both part of NZRC.

The country's rail operator and tracks will be overseen by one state-owned enterprise, Finance Minister Michael Cullen announced today.

Dr Cullen said from October 1, KiwiRail and Ontrack would report to the board of the New Zealand Railways Corporation, which would be chaired by former prime minister Jim Bolger. (NZPA) pub in ODT, 24 Sep 2008 [1]
